Gutter Contractors in Alaska
Southeast Alaska can top 150 inches of annual rainfall, and even interior regions deal with heavy snowmelt that stresses gutter systems every spring. Ice damming is a real concern in colder zones, where freeze-thaw cycles can pull gutters away from fascia boards over time. A contractor familiar with both wet climates and cold-weather installation makes a meaningful difference here.
